Here are some tips that will help you start a local online marketing campaign.
- Claim your Google Business Profile listing
Google displays a map of business listings when people search for a local business. But to appear on this map, you need to be registered for a Google Business Profile. These listings are free, and claiming your business will increase your online visibility. This makes it an essential step for any locally focused business. Simply go to your Google Business Profile and follow the instructions to get started.
- List your business in local directories
Canadian businesses should take advantage of local online directories. You can also do an Internet search for business directories in your area and add your company to any of those listings.
- Establish a business presence on Facebook
Facebook is all about building and nurturing relationships and can be a means of reaching both new and existing customers as part of local marketing campaigns. When you create a Facebook page with your business profile, you can choose to be featured as a local business.
Make sure your page has a professional look and offers engaging content that reflects your business culture and values.
- Participate in local blogs and online forums
Increase your visibility by leaving comments or writing guest posts on local blogs and Internet forums. Make sure your signature includes your contact information and website address.
It's also a good idea to be active on social media platforms that your customers use, such as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n. By posting and commenting on other people's posts, you can become part of a community and position yourself as an expert in your field.
- Get exposure on local websites
Building relationships with other organizations, such as local charities, professional associations and the media, can gain you exposure on the local internet when they publish news about your business.
- Make it easier for local customers to find you on the Internet
If you want your website to appear at the top of the list when local users search online for your products and services, you should choose keywords that describe your unique offering and geographic location. Make sure you build your local web presence using the right SEO techniques.
And don't forget: your website is the cornerstone of your marketing strategy. Make sure your contact information appears on every page.
- Localize your pay-per-click advertising
Most search engines offer the option to localize your internet advertising with pay-per-click. Decide on the geographic area you want to target and reach your target audience.
